Q: How to service the radiator grille and bumper cover on Ford F-150?
A: To replace Radiator grille and Bumper cover, remove Air Deflector all-pin-type intercooler radiator bracket retention. Next, unscrew the two bolts, and dismount the air deflector/intercooler radiator bracket of the vehicle frame. Put the intercooler radiator aside, and take out the screws that hold the bumper cover radiator grille. Installation In reverse.
Q: How to service the radiator grille on Ford F-150?
A: To service the radiator grille, the hood must be raised using tool I6612, the service jack handle must be removed and the front upper Air Deflector removed. Take out the headlamps, combination lamps, and eight guard pin-type retainers made of stone and then ten radiator grille screws. Lastly, remove radiator grille and repeat the steps in installing.
